WebSizzle cymbals (factory-fitted with rivets), could be ordered in 18 and 20 inch sizes. Concert cymbals were available in 14, 15 and 16 inch pairs. There was also a budget alternative to the 5 Star Super Zyn, called the 2 Star Super Zyn. Web1. Also known as "zills", finger cymbals consist of two tiny cymbals that attach to the finger and thumb of each hand and are then hit together. Originating from Turkey, finger cymbals are often used by belly dancers, but their ability to produce a wide array of unique tones makes them ideal for marching bands and orchestral performances as well.
